Gray/Grey Literature Definitions

• Publicly available, foreign or domestic, open source information that usually is available through specialized channels and may not enter normal channels or systems of publication, distribution, bibliographic control, or acquisition by book sellers or subscription agents.– US Interagency Gray Literature Working Group

• That which is produced on all levels of government, academics, business and industry in print and electronic formats, but which is not controlled by commercial publishers.– Fourth International Conference on Grey Literature (GL '99), Washington,

DC, October 1999. See www.greynet.org

Gray literature characteristics

• Difficult to identify, acquire, process and access• Large body of information in an international scope• Limited quantities produced for a targeted audience• Nonstandard formats• Not formally published• Not easy to catalog• Quality

– unrefereed– questions of integrity & authenticity

Value of gray literature

• User perspective– varies by user groups– varies with time and place

• More timely than conventional literature• May be more concise, focused & detailed

• Can corroborate important assertions found in other sources

• Informal, more common information exchange

Types of gray literature

• Academic papers• Committee reports• Conference papers• Corporate documents• Discussion papers• Dissertations• Government reports• House journals• Market surveys• Newsletters• PowerPoint presentations

• Preprints• Proceedings• Research reports• Standards• Technical reports• Theses• Trade Literature• Translations• Trip reports• Working papers

DTIC Technical Reports CollectionTypes of documents selected

· Acquisition Life Cycle Documents

· DoD Lab Annual Reports

· Bibliographies

· Command Histories

· Conference Proceedings & Papers

· Dissertations & Theses

· DoD Functional Area Dictionaries/Glossaries

· Federally Funded Research & Development Center (FFRDC) Reports

· Journal Articles & Reprints (DoD-supported)

· Lessons Learned (DoD-related)

· Mission Area Plans

· NATO Research and Technology Organization (RTO) Documents

· Newsletters (DoD-related)

· DoD Patents & Patent Applications

· Defense Planning Guidance

· Technical Reports

· Test reports

· Technical memos

· Studies & analyses

DTIC Technical Reports Collection

Types of documents not selected • Administrative Papers

• Advertisements

• Blueprints

• Brochures, Catalogs & Posters

• Charts Circulars

• Conference Programs and Agendas

• Contracting Documents & Materials

• Correspondence

• Decision Papers

• Engineering Drawings

• Forms

• Memoranda (Inter-Office)

• Memorandums of Agreement (MOAs)

• Operating Instructions

• Procedures Promotional Materials

• Proposals

• Technical Manuals

• Telephone Directories

• Trip Reports

Broader distribution• National Technical Information Service (NTIS)

Cataloged OPAC

Database access: Dialog, Cambridge Scientific Abstracts, Questel, and STN/Chem Abstracts

• Library of Congress (Science Library)Not cataloged; no database access

• Canada Institute of Scientific and Technical Information (CISTI)Cataloged OPACDatabase access: OCLC World Cat

• British Library (BLDSC)Not cataloged

• Libraries and collections world-wide

Gray literature and copyright• Copyright vests automatically to the author

– at the time a work is created and fixed in a discernable format.

– No notice or formalities are required.

• Public release does not equal public domain.• Information sponsored by or provided by the U.S.

Government may be copyrighted.– Works authored by U.S. Government employees as part of

their official duties are not copyrighted in the U.S. However, these works may include copyrighted material used with permission.

– Contractors and grantees are not considered government employees.
